Simply Felt: 20 Easy and Elegant Designs in Wool Natural, tough, and beautiful—felt is an extraordinary textile.
Using natural woolen fibers hand-rubbed with water, you can create a durable,
versatile fabric for making a wonderful collection of garments and home
accessories. Best of all, felt never frays. Authors Margaret Docherty,
an expert felt maker and teacher, and Jayne Emerson, a textile designer,
have teamed up to present the fundamentals of felting: choosing fibers
and colors, making flat felt and boiling felt, and stitching felt. They
also cover the more advanced process of inlaying other fibers to vary
felt design and texture. The felting techniques are demonstrated with
20 beautiful projects in a range of contemporary colors; projects include
a cozy cloche hat, a charming child's jacket, warm slippers, delicate
scarves, square and inlayed throw pillows, and an exquisite, long-lasting
rug. Each project is presented with simple, step-by-step instructions
and illustrations, and offers alternative samples and suggestions that
help you to create your own designs. Now you can bring the highly sought-after
handcrafted style of felt into your wardrobe and home décor-this
book promises to make it simple, and oh, so beautiful. |
